Analyzing the Cavaliers' Strengths and Exploiting Weaknesses

The Cavaliers' success stems from a potent combination of factors, and the Celtics must address these to stand a chance.

Dominant Cavs' Inside Game

Jarrett Allen and Evan Mobley form a formidable frontcourt duo. Their impact is undeniable:

  • Jarrett Allen's impact: Allen's dominance on the boards and his efficient scoring in the paint have been key to Cleveland's success.
  • Evan Mobley's defensive prowess: Mobley's defensive versatility and shot-blocking ability make him a nightmare matchup for opposing big men.
  • Limiting their post touches: The Celtics need to limit post touches for both players, forcing them into less efficient jump shots.
  • Double-teaming strategies: Employing more double-teams strategically could disrupt their offensive rhythm and force turnovers.
  • Exploiting their perimeter defense: While strong inside, the Cavaliers' perimeter defense can be exploited with smart off-ball movement and quick passes.

The Celtics need to develop a strategy to counter this inside dominance. This could involve more aggressive double-teaming, forcing the ball out to less reliable shooters, and securing more rebounds to limit second-chance points. Al Horford's experience and defensive acumen will be vital in this battle.

Containing Donovan Mitchell's Offensive Explosions

Donovan Mitchell is a dynamic scorer capable of single-handedly taking over games. Containing him will be paramount for Boston's success:

  • Defensive schemes against Mitchell: Implementing various defensive schemes – switching, trapping, hedging – to disrupt his rhythm is essential.
  • Switching strategies: Strategic switching between Jayson Tatum and Jaylen Brown could wear him down and force turnovers.
  • Using Jayson Tatum/Jaylen Brown to guard him: Their length and athleticism could make him work harder for his points.
  • Limiting his drives: The Celtics must limit his penetration to the basket, forcing him into more contested jump shots.
  • Forcing turnovers: Aggressive on-ball pressure and smart defensive rotations are necessary to generate turnovers and disrupt Cleveland's offensive flow.

Mitchell's ability to score in bunches makes him a significant threat. The Celtics need to employ a combination of physical and mental strategies to minimize his impact. This requires consistent defensive effort and effective communication among the Celtics’ defenders.

Celtics' Adjustments and Potential Game Changers

To even the series, Boston needs significant adjustments in several key areas.

Improving Offensive Efficiency

Game 3 highlighted some offensive shortcomings for the Celtics. They need to:

  • Improving three-point shooting percentage: Increasing their three-point percentage is crucial for better spacing and higher scoring output.
  • Attacking the basket more effectively: Driving to the basket and creating scoring opportunities at the rim will be crucial.
  • Better ball movement: Improved ball movement will create more open shots and reduce reliance on individual heroics.
  • Reducing turnovers: Minimizing turnovers is paramount to maintain offensive possessions and control the tempo.

The Celtics need to be more aggressive in attacking the basket and creating higher-percentage shots. Improved ball movement and decision-making are key to unlocking their offensive potential.

Elevating Defensive Intensity

Boston's defense needs to be more consistent and intense.

  • Increasing defensive pressure: Applying consistent pressure on the ball will force more turnovers and disrupt Cleveland's offense.
  • Improving rebounding: Dominating the boards will limit second-chance points for the Cavaliers.
  • Better communication: Improved communication between players is crucial to cover for each other effectively.
  • Limiting second-chance points: Reducing second-chance opportunities will be crucial to controlling the tempo and momentum of the game.

A more aggressive and communicative defense will be vital in slowing down the Cavaliers and controlling the game's flow.
